What is Human Growth Hormone (HGH)?

Human Growth Hormone (HGH) is a peptide hormone produced by the anterior pituitary gland that plays a critical role in growth, body composition, cell repair, and metabolism in humans. It is comprised of 191 amino acids and is essential for physical growth in children and teens, as well as maintenance of tissues and organs throughout life.

Functions of HGH:

  1. Growth Stimulation: HGH stimulates growth in almost all tissues of the body, particularly bones and muscles. It promotes the synthesis of proteins and the growth of cartilage, leading to increased height during childhood and adolescence.

  2. Regulating Metabolism: HGH influences the metabolism of carbohydrates, proteins, and fats. It promotes gluconeogenesis (the production of glucose from non-carbohydrate sources), enhances lipolysis (the breakdown of fats), and can increase overall metabolic rate.

  3. Muscle Mass Increase: HGH plays a role in increasing muscle mass by promoting muscle protein synthesis. This can lead to enhanced athletic performance and physical strength.

  4. Bone Mineralization: HGH promotes the retention of calcium and stimulates the production of bone-forming cells, which helps in the maintenance of bone density.

  5. Cellular Repair and Regeneration: HGH aids in the regeneration of tissues and supports recovery after injury. It is involved in cellular turnover, influencing both growth and repair processes.

Regulation of HGH:

HGH secretion is regulated by various factors including:

  • Age: Levels are highest during childhood and decline with age.
  • Sleep: HGH is secreted in pulses throughout the day, with the largest pulse occurring shortly after the onset of deep sleep.
  • Exercise: Physical activity stimulates HGH secretion, particularly high-intensity exercise.

Clinical Use:

HGH is used in medicine to treat growth disorders in children and hormone deficiency in adults. Synthetic forms of HGH are available and can be prescribed to address these conditions. However, misuse of HGH for performance enhancement in sports and bodybuilding raises ethical concerns and potential health risks, including diabetes, joint swelling, and increased risk of certain cancers.

Potential Risks and Side Effects:

When used outside of medical supervision, growth hormone can lead to various side effects, such as:

  • Arthralgia (joint pain)
  • Carpal tunnel syndrome
  • Edema (swelling)
  • Increased risk of diabetes
  • Elevated cholesterol levels
